1. Hangzhou Silk Industrial Cluster – “Silk Capital of China”
Location: Hangzhou City, Zhejiang Province
Overview: With over 2,000 years of silk production history, Hangzhou is China’s premier silk manufacturing center and home to the world’s largest silk trading market. The cluster encompasses complete silk production from sericulture through weaving, dyeing, printing, and garment manufacturing.
Key Market Complex:
China Silk City (中国丝绸城):
World’s largest professional silk market
4,000+ permanent merchants
Annual trading volume: 30+ billion RMB
10 specialized trading zones covering 500,000 square meters
Industrial Specialties:
Silk Products:
Pure silk fabrics (charmeuse, crepe de chine, habotai, chiffon, organza)
Silk home textiles (bedding, curtains, pillowcases)
Product Categories by Quality:
Premium Grade: 19-22 momme silk, tight weave, superior dye fastness
Standard Grade: 16-19 momme silk, good quality for general use
Budget Grade: Lower momme count, suitable for linings and decorative use
Manufacturing Advantages:
Complete silk ecosystem from silkworm farming to finished products
Advanced dyeing and printing technologies
Digital printing capabilities for custom designs
Over 300 years of accumulated expertise
National Silk Quality Supervision and Inspection Center located here
Strong R&D in silk fiber innovation
Hangzhou Silk Characteristics:
Lustrous finish and smooth hand-feel
Excellent drape and breathability
Superior color fastness
Available in widths from 90cm to 280cm
Minimum order quantities negotiable (often 50-100 meters per color/pattern)
Industry Events:
China International Silk Expo: Held annually in Hangzhou
Monthly fashion fabric launches
Regular designer showcases and trend presentations
Best For: Fashion designers seeking silk, bridal fabric buyers, luxury home textile sourcing, scarf and accessory manufacturers, high-end garment production.
2. Shishi Fabric Industrial Cluster, Fujian
Location: Shishi City, Quanzhou Prefecture, Fujian Province
Overview: Known as “China’s Casual Wear Capital,” Shishi has evolved into one of China’s most important textile trading centers, particularly strong in synthetic fabrics, sportswear materials, and casual wear textiles. The cluster serves as a crucial link between fabric production and China’s massive garment manufacturing industry.
Key Market Complex:
Shishi Fabric Market (石狮布料市场):
China’s largest synthetic fabric wholesale market
8,000+ fabric merchants and agents
Connected directly to local textile mills
Annual trading volume: 80+ billion RMB
Specializes in ready-stock and quick-delivery fabrics
Largest inventory of ready-stock synthetic fabrics in China
Competitive pricing due to cluster economies
Quick sampling and prototyping
Flexible minimum order quantities
Strong logistics network with nationwide delivery
Export-oriented business model with experienced traders
Shishi Business Model:
“Front shop, back factory” structure common
Many vendors represent multiple mills
Stock available for immediate purchase
Custom orders welcome with reasonable MOQs
Negotiable pricing, especially for volume
Best For: Sportswear and activewear manufacturers, outdoor gear producers, fast fashion brands, swimwear companies, casual wear manufacturers, buyers needing quick turnaround.
3. Guangzhou Textile Manufacturing Hub
Location: Haizhu District, Guangzhou City, Guangdong Province
Overview: Guangzhou’s textile industry benefits from its position in the Pearl River Delta manufacturing ecosystem, offering comprehensive fabric varieties from basic to premium. The cluster serves both domestic and international markets with strong export capabilities.
Key Market Complexes:
Guangzhou Zhongda Fabric Market (中大布匹市场):
South China’s largest fabric wholesale center
3,000+ shops and stalls
Strong in fashion fabrics and garment materials
Annual trading volume: 50+ billion RMB
Guangzhou International Textile City:
Modern exhibition and trading complex
Focus on mid-to-high-end fabrics
International buyer services
Product Categories:
Fashion Fabrics:
Cotton and linen varieties
Wool and wool blends
Lace and embroidery
Printed and dyed fabrics
Jacquard and dobby weaves
Velvet and corduroy
Specialty Materials:
Sequined and beaded fabrics
Metallic and lamé textiles
Tulle and netting
Faux fur and suede
Wedding and evening wear fabrics
Home Textiles:
Upholstery fabrics
Curtain and drapery materials
Decorative textiles
Bedding fabrics
Sourcing Advantages:
Proximity to Guangzhou’s garment manufacturing district
Access to Pearl River Delta fabric mills
Wide variety in one location
Competitive pricing across quality tiers
Sample purchasing friendly
Many vendors speak basic English
Well-developed export logistics
Market Characteristics:
Mix of wholesale and smaller quantity sales
Negotiable pricing (expect to bargain)
Stock fabrics and custom order options
MOQs vary by vendor (typically 30-100 meters for stock, 300+ for custom)
Fast delivery within Guangzhou area
Export documentation support available
Best For: Fashion designers and brands, garment manufacturers, wedding dress makers, costume designers, home textile buyers, smaller quantity buyers.

Location: Xiqiao Town, Nanhai District, Foshan City, Guangdong Province
Overview: Known as “China’s Textile Town,” Xiqiao specializes in high-quality knitted fabrics and home textiles, with particular strength in innovative and functional textiles. The cluster combines traditional craftsmanship with modern technology.
Key Market Complex:
Xiqiao Textile Market (西樵纺织市场):
Focus on knitted fabrics and home textiles
5,000+ businesses
Strong in innovative and technical fabrics
Annual output: 10+ billion meters
Product Specialties:
Knitted Fabrics:
Jersey knits (single jersey, double jersey, interlock)
Rib knits
French terry and fleece
Ponte and scuba knits
Mesh and spacer fabrics
Performance knits (moisture-wicking, compression)
Innovative Textiles:
Eco-friendly fabrics (bamboo, modal, lyocell)
Smart textiles with special functions
Jacquard knits
Seamless fabric technology
3D spacer fabrics
Home Textiles:
Curtain fabrics (sheer, blackout, decorative)
Upholstery materials
Bedding textiles
Toweling fabrics
Table linens
Manufacturing Strengths:
Advanced circular knitting technology
Warp knitting capabilities
Innovative dyeing and finishing
Functional treatment expertise
Design and R&D centers
Sustainable production practices
Industry Characteristics:
Strong focus on innovation and technology
Increasing emphasis on eco-friendly production
Active in international fabric exhibitions
Collaboration with international brands
Investment in automation and smart manufacturing
Best For: Activewear brands, intimate apparel manufacturers, home textile buyers, buyers seeking innovative fabrics, sustainable textile sourcing.
6. Haining Home Textile Industrial Cluster, Zhejiang
Location: Haining City, Jiaxing Prefecture, Zhejiang Province
Overview: Haining is China’s premier home textile production base, particularly famous for warp knitting technology. The city has evolved from traditional textile manufacturing to become a global leader in curtain fabrics and home décor textiles.
Key Market Complex:
Haining Home Textile Market (海宁家纺市场):
China’s largest curtain fabric market
3,000+ specialized merchants
Focus on home décor textiles
Annual trading volume: 40+ billion RMB
Product Specialties:
Curtain Fabrics:
Jacquard curtains (European, American, new Chinese styles)
Blackout curtains
Sheer and voile fabrics
Linen-look curtain materials
Velvet curtains
Smart curtain fabrics (motorized compatible)
Home Textile Materials:
Sofa and upholstery fabrics
Cushion and pillow textiles
Table linens and runners
Bedding fabrics
Decorative throws
Technical Capabilities:
Advanced warp knitting (tricot, raschel)
Multi-bar jacquard technology
Digital printing on home textiles
Flame-retardant finishing
Waterproof and stain-resistant treatments
Manufacturing Excellence:
Over 800 warp knitting machines
Complete vertical integration
Strong design capabilities with European influence
Quick sampling (3-7 days)
Flexible production (MOQ: 100-300 meters for custom designs)
Industry Innovation:
Smart home textile integration
Eco-friendly materials development
Collaboration with international designers
Trend forecasting and design centers
Regular new product launches
Best For: Home décor retailers, interior designers, curtain manufacturers, furniture manufacturers, hotel and hospitality buyers, home textile brands.
